The Railway Recruitment Board will be conducting the RPF (Railway Police Force) Constable Examination 2025 to select candidates for 4,208 vacancies from March 2 to 20, 2025.
Eligibility: Both male and female candidates are eligible to apply for the exam.
Exam pattern
The exam consists of 120 questions, each carrying one mark, making the total score 120 marks.
The exam consists of three main subjects:
Basic Arithmetic – Tests numerical ability and problem-solving skills.
General Intelligence and Reasoning – Assesses logical reasoning and analytical thinking.
General Awareness – Evaluates knowledge of current affairs, history, geography, and general science.
Selection process
Stage 1: Computer-Based Test (CBT)
The first stage is a Computer-Based Test (CBT), which evaluates candidates on subjects like General Awareness, Arithmetic, General Intelligence, and Reasoning.
Stage 2: Physical Efficiency Test (PET)
Candidates who qualify in the CBT must participate in the Physical Efficiency Test (PET), which includes activities like running, long jump, and high jump. The required standards may differ based on gender.
Stage 3: Physical Measurement Test (PMT)
Those who pass the PET must undergo a Physical Measurement Test (PMT) to ensure they meet the specified physical standards.
Stage 4: Document Verification
Candidates clearing the PET and PMT must submit necessary documents for verification, including educational certificates, identity proof, and other required documents.
